Exegesis

The aorist verb apekrithēsan {ἀπεκρίθησαν | apekríthēsan} opens the reply and foregrounds the act of answering before identifying the speakers.

Root and etymology

apokrinomaialpha pi omicron kappa rho iota nu omicron mu alpha iota

to answer, respond

In contextJohn 10:33

The Jews answered Him , “We are not stoning You on account of a good work, but on account of blasphemy, and because You, being a man, make Yourself God .”
